OKLAHOMA CITY
- Construction contracts to widen portions of the Creek and Kilpatrick turnpikes are expected to be put up for bids early next year, the Oklahoma Turnpike Authority was told Friday.

During a special meeting, the authority voted to move forward with the sale of bonds to finance the projects in Tulsa and Oklahoma City.

The Turnpike Authority plans to add inside lanes to the Creek Turnpike from U.S. 75 to Memorial Drive. The project involves about seven miles.

Inside lanes also will be added to the Kilpatrick Turnpike from Eastern Avenue to MacArthur Boulevard. The project involves about 7 1/2 miles.

The additional lanes are needed to alleviate traffic congestion, officials have said.

A spokesman said Gov. Mary Fallin supports the projects because they will "cut down on congestion, improve safety and do so without raising tolls." FULL ARTICLE
